Ex-Inmate Claims Knife Attack Against Diddy Stemmed From Argument Over A Chair & “Basketball Wives”

We’re getting more insight into what reportedly went down when Sean “Diddy” Combs was nearly attacked behind bars.
Raymond Castillo, a former inmate at the Metropolitan Detention Center in Brooklyn, spoke out to clarify reports that Diddy woke up to a homemade knife at his throat. “He didn’t ‘wake up’ to no knife to his neck,” Castillo said. “And I was the one who intervened.” According to Castillo, the incident wasn’t a planned attack but rather a dispute that started over a chair and the TV. Castillo claimed a #WestCoast gang member serving a 30-year sentence wanted Diddy to give up the seat he was using while watching #BasketballWives.

“The guy got hostile… maybe looking for clout,” Castillo explained. “Diddy didn’t flinch. He stayed calm, told him, ‘Why you coming at me like that over a chair that don’t belong to none of us?’” Castillo said the inmate then pulled out a handmade knife, but he managed to grab the man’s arm before anyone got hurt. “Diddy just got up and told him, ‘You might need to pray,’” Castillo added. “He tried to calm the guy down and even offered to pray with him. I’ve never seen anyone handle it like that.”
